Auxiliary Cords for Your iPhone

Monday, November 22, 2010
posted by hemant

One of the ways that an individual can enjoy their iPhone is to purchase auxiliary cords.  These cords allow the individual to plug their device into an audio jack on a receiver or other entertainment device, which will allow them to play music over the speakers.  Other cords can also be purchased to broadcast an image on a television or other screen.
